Our analysis looked at 7 schools in Colorado to see which basic certificate programs offered the best value experiences for somatic bodywork students with the aim of identifying those quality schools that are more affordable than some of their counterparts.

This ranking is not just a list of inexpensive schools. We also consider each school's quality, since we believe a low-quality school may not be a 'bargain' at any price. More specifically, we discount our quality score by the published tuition and fees charged by a school. This gives the cost per unit of quality for each college. The value is determined by how much quality your dollar buys.

For nationwide and regional rankings, we use out-of-state tuition and fees in our calculations. Average in-state tuition and fees are used for our statewide rankings.

Our 2023 rankings named Colorado School of Healing Arts the best value school in Colorado for somatic bodywork & therapeutic services students working on their basic certificate. CSHA is a fairly small private for-profit school located in the midsize city of Lakewood.

CSHA undergraduate students pay an average of $11,600 in in-state tuition and fees each year.
